Sinner Stages Epic Fightback To Win Australian Open

Posted on

Jannik Sinner of Italy jubilantly raises the Norman Brookes Challenge Cup following his triumph over Russia's Daniil Medvedev in the men's singles final at the Australian Open tennis tournament in Melbourne on January 29, 2024. Photo: AFP.

Italian tennis player Jannik Sinner achieved a stunning comeback on Sunday to win his first Grand Slam title at the Australian Open. Sinner, the fourth seed, battled back from two sets down to defeat Russian Daniil Medvedev in a grueling five-set final, securing a historic victory.

In a match lasting three hours and 44 minutes, Sinner displayed resilience and determination, winning 3-6, 3-6, 6-4, 6-4, 6-3. The victory marked a significant milestone for the 22-year-old, who became the first Italian man to win a Grand Slam since 1976.

Medvedev, ranked third globally, had a strong start, dominating the first two sets with his aggressive play. However, Sinner fought back, showcasing an impressive performance that included 14 aces, 50 winners, and breaking Medvedev’s serve four times.

The Italian collapsed to the floor in celebration after match point, emphasizing the emotional significance of the win. Sinner’s triumph makes him the youngest man to win the Australian Open since Novak Djokovic in 2008.

While Sinner praised Medvedev for his outstanding efforts throughout the tournament, the Russian acknowledged Sinner’s deserving victory. Medvedev, who has now lost five of six Grand Slam finals, expressed hope for future success.

Sinner’s win not only secured his place in tennis history but also delivered a bitter blow to Medvedev, who faced a similar situation in the 2022 Australian Open final against Rafael Nadal.

In his victory speech, Sinner thanked his team and expressed gratitude for the special atmosphere at the Slam. The Italian’s remarkable journey to his first Grand Slam title adds a new chapter to the evolving landscape of men’s tennis.
